Hi,
All you have to do is to hook into the login function. See the documentation here: https://docs.djangoproject.com/en/1.10/topics/auth/default/#how-to-log-a-user-in. You can also rewrite the login function to do as you please (we have done that on a project), however this means that you have to update that function every time you update django.
